The ratrod concept was a sound one
Hulks and pieces from the entire Australian automobile industry from the 30's up to bout the 80's all mismatched and stuck together for ultimate violence looked real good

Cars newer then the 80's just dont look the part
They just dont look as powerful and menacing as when they used to make cars out of metal

But I think they went too far with the monster trucks and stuff
(Among other things he went too far with like all the guns and all the you know what)

Just take that pretty ratrod style and dial it back a smidge more realistic like MM2 was
Basically the cars from MM2 but with more dents and rust and even more mismatched, cobbled together and bizarre

I was only thinking the other day, how in MM2 there is the reference to the "last of the v8 interceptors"
when you think now with Holden and Ford closing down locally made cars, there isn't going to be anymore V8's made.

I could see a reference to that being used in fan fiction, future films,

From what I've seen in the news people are paying over $10,000 above the new sticker price to get "one of the last V8's"
